Appeal
An appeal is a request for your health insurance company, the health insurance
payers from the provider, or the patient to review a decision that denied an
authorization. To create an appeal case, in the Patient 360 profile of a specified member, click For more information about appeal case management, see the Pega Care Management

page. To create an appeal case in the Pega Care Management application, fill in the
required details such as contact channel, urgency, requesting provider, member, and denied
authorization list. Use the following rules to configure a different source based on your
organization's requirements. pyContactChannel Urgency D_GetProviderList D_MemberPresentFuturePol D_ListOfDeniedAuthorizations FinalDisposition After the intake is complete, appeals are routed to medical directors for review.
During the review, if the appeal is approved, then the system captures
CertificationIssueDate and
CertificationEffectiveDate as system dates and
CertificationExpirationDate based on the authorization type, for
example inpatient or outpatient. Use this decision tree rule to make updates to the expiration days based on the request
type. Based on the decision outcome, the status of the authorization is set. You can update
the status of the authorization based on the authorization decision and the reject reason
that you configured. For example, you could change Reject to
Denied. Based on the appeal decision outcome, correspondence is sent to the respective
parties. You determine the correspondence template by using a decision table. Use the ResolutionCorr decision table. Data model
